We are looking for an experienced Senior Lab Technician who thrives in a biotech/pharma environment, while understanding the complexities of lab operations and supporting scientists in an R&D setting. This is a great opportunity to make an impact, drive improvements, and be valued for your expertise, within a company working on cutting edge science in a state-of-the-art facility. This is a permanent full time, on-site role in Cambridge.

In this role you will be responsible for the purchasing, maintenance and calibration of various lab equipment, as well as the management of critical R&D supplies such as gas bottles & cryogenic vessels. You will also work closely with the facilities manager, on continuous improvement projects with a focus on environmental and sustainability initiatives.

Excellent attention to detail and communication skills are essential for this role, if you also have experience with inventory & stock management software that would be fantastic.
